DARIEN FIRE & RESCUE

115.00 - FIRE DEPARTMENT CHAPLAIN

I. Function: Fire Department Chaplain (Serving on a Volunteer basis)

The Fire Department Chaplain serves in a volunteer capacity at the discretion of the Fire Chief. The Chaplain will maintain a crisis ministry to assist department members, members' families and civilians in coping with the physical, spiritual and emotional aspects of personal tragedy. The Chaplain will be a person of faith, ministering to all people regardless of the particular faith or value system.

II. Guidelines:

A. Position requires minimal supervision and extensive independent judgment. Instruction will be in the form of oral or written direction from the Fire Chief as to the broad objectives to be accomplished. General directions from time to time may also be received from the Incident Command at a disaster scene.

B. The Chaplain will be issued, a badge and identification card for access to fire scenes and such. The Chaplain will be issued, a pager for call as requested by Incident Command. The Chaplain will be under the authority of the Incident Command at a hazardous scene and will act as a liaison to the victim and victims' family in support of the Incident Commander. The Chaplain will maintain the utmost concern for both his own safety and the safety of any victim while fulfilling his duties. Only under authority of and with Incident Command's knowledge, may the Chaplain enter into the warm or hot zone at an incident scene.

C. In order to carry out his function properly, the Chaplain will conduct periodic visits to each station and shift as seen fit. The Chaplain will be permitted opportunities to ride with the Firefighters to gain first hand knowledge of the role and lifestyle of a firefighter. The Chaplain may attend and participate in training exercises with the permission of the officer in charge of the exercise.

III. Special Conditions:

The Fire Department Chaplain position is a volunteer position and does not qualify for employee compensation or benefits of any kind. The Chaplain will assume all personal liability in the performance of his or her duties and not hold the City of Darien liable in the event of any accident or mishap while performing the duties of his office.
